Roasted Chicken With Buttery Chipotle, Cumin And Cilantro

Serves 4
Recipe By: Robin Miller
Published in: Robin To The Rescue

Cooking Spray
4 halves chicken breast -- skinless boneless
salt and pepper
2 tablespoon butter -- unsalted softened
2 teaspoon chipotles chiles in adobo -- chopped
1 teaspoon cumin -- ground
1/4 cup cilantro -- chopped

Preheat the oven to 400F Coat a roasting pan with cooking spray. Season
the chicken all over with salt and pepper and place on the prepared pan..
In a small bowl, mix the butter, chipotles, and cumin until well blended.
Spread the butter mixture evenly over the chicken in the pan. Roast until
chicken is cookedthrough, about 25 minutes. Sprinkle the cilantro over the
chicken just before serving.

Recipe Notes
Meet your Quick Fix butter sauce. This version is smoky and hot, but
try other flavor combination, like parsley and dill or basil and mint
(nice with pork or lamb).
